Security Officer I
CurrentProvides for the security and protection of property in a state office building or other public facility on an assigned shift. Conducts regular rounds throughout the building and/or grounds observing the demeanor of the public, employees, residents, or patients; takes necessary action to ensure that proper conduct is observed. Reports questionable conduct of employees, residents, patients, or the public to an immediate supervisor or other administrator. Investigates acts of vandalism or theft and works closely with law enforcement officials on investigations whenever necessary. Prepares and submits reports of infractions of laws, regulations, and/or rules that occur on the grounds or within the building. Responds to routine questions and provides directions to the public. Assists in implementing training programs involving security procedures. Assists in organizing and conducting searches when patients/residents walk away or escape; assists in handling agitated patients/residents. Takes necessary action in removing unruly individuals or detaining them until they can be turned over to the proper authorities. Dispatches institutional vehicles; receives reports of difficulties with the vehicles and arranges for repairs; checks oil and gas to assure readiness for the next dispatch. Assists other facility personnel in maintaining security and assuring that necessary precautionary measures are taken for the protection of people and property. Conducts fire prevention inspections and responds to all fire alarms. Receives supervision from a higher-level Security Officer or other designated administrative supervisor. Performs other related work as assigned.
